WebWhen we are first introduced to Scrooge, Dickens uses a simile to describe him as “as secret, and self-contained, and solitary as an oyster.” This suggests that Scrooge silentlyhides away from others. There is a sense that he is quiet and is unsociable. The word ‘secret’ implies that there is something unknown, maybe even unspoken, about Scrooge. WebJun 14, 2008 · Dickens also in a Christmas Carol characterizes the oyster as: “ Secret, and self-contained, and solitary as an oyster”. He also wrote a short story called Love and Oysters which he later re-titled The Misplaced Attachment of Mr John Dounce who gave up his friends and family for his infatuation for an oyster girl who refused his advances.
